The Power of Diversity in IT Staffing
Diversity in the workplace is not only a moral imperative but also a strategic advantage when it comes to IT staffing. By bringing together individuals from different backgrounds, experiences, and perspectives, organizations can foster innovation and creativity within their teams. Research has shown that diverse teams are more likely to outperform homogenous teams, as they are better equipped to tackle complex problems and come up with creative solutions. To create a culture of innovation in IT staffing, organizations should prioritize diversity and inclusion in their hiring processes. This can involve implementing diversity training, creating affinity groups, and actively seeking out diverse candidates through targeted recruitment efforts. By embracing diversity, organizations can tap into a wealth of unique ideas and insights that can drive innovation and propel them ahead in the digital landscape.
Nurturing a Collaborative Environment
Collaboration is essential in fostering a culture of innovation within IT staffing. When individuals are encouraged to work together, share ideas, and collaborate on projects, they are more likely to come up with innovative solutions that can lead to business success. To create a collaborative environment, organizations should invest in tools and technologies that facilitate communication and teamwork, such as project management software, collaboration platforms, and video conferencing tools. Additionally, leaders should create opportunities for team members to work together on cross-functional projects, participate in brainstorming sessions, and engage in peer-to-peer feedback. By fostering a collaborative environment, organizations can harness the collective intelligence of their teams and drive innovation in IT staffing.
Empowering Employees through Continuous Learning
Innovation thrives in environments where individuals are empowered to learn, grow, and develop their skills. To create a culture of innovation in IT staffing, organizations should prioritize continuous learning and professional development for their employees. This can involve offering training programs, workshops, and conferences to help employees stay up-to-date on the latest technologies and trends in the industry. Additionally, organizations can encourage employees to pursue certifications, attend online courses, and engage in self-directed learning to enhance their skills and knowledge. By empowering employees through continuous learning, organizations can equip their teams with the tools they need to innovate, adapt to change, and drive success in IT staffing.
Fostering a Culture of Experimentation and Risk-Taking
Innovation requires a willingness to take risks, experiment with new ideas, and learn from failure. To create a culture of innovation in IT staffing, organizations should encourage team members to take calculated risks, try out new approaches, and learn from their mistakes. This can involve creating a safe space for experimentation, where individuals are encouraged to share their ideas, test out prototypes, and gather feedback from colleagues. Leaders should also demonstrate a willingness to take risks themselves, leading by example and showing that failure is an essential part of the innovation process. By fostering a culture of experimentation and risk-taking, organizations can drive creativity, inspire innovation, and stay ahead in the rapidly evolving digital landscape.
Encouraging Open Communication and Feedback
Effective communication is key to fostering a culture of innovation within IT staffing. When team members are encouraged to communicate openly, share their ideas, and provide feedback, they are more likely to collaborate effectively and come up with innovative solutions. To encourage open communication, organizations should create channels for feedback, such as regular team meetings, one-on-one discussions, and anonymous surveys. Leaders should also be approachable and open to feedback, creating a culture of psychological safety where team members feel comfortable sharing their thoughts and ideas. By encouraging open communication and feedback, organizations can break down silos, foster a culture of transparency, and empower their teams to innovate and excel in IT staffing.
